The goal of preventive measures in public health is to proactively reduce incidences of diseases. This approach focuses on identifying and addressing risk factors that can lead to health problems before they occur. Preventive measures aim not just to manage health issues as they arise but to mitigate their occurrence, ultimately leading to improved population health outcomes and reduced healthcare costs.

By implementing strategies such as vaccination programs, health education, and screening, public health professionals work to prevent diseases from taking hold in communities. This proactive stance is fundamental to the mission of public health, as it emphasizes the importance of health promotion and disease prevention to enhance overall well-being.
